doveadm-cluster-tag

NAME

doveadm-cluster-tag - Utility actions for Dovecot Cluster tag

SYNOPSIS

doveadm [GLOBAL OPTIONS] cluster tag create [ --id id ] name

doveadm [GLOBAL OPTIONS] cluster tag delete name|id

doveadm [GLOBAL OPTIONS] cluster tag update [ --name name ] name|id

doveadm [GLOBAL OPTIONS] cluster tag list

DESCRIPTION

doveadm cluster tag can be used to run actions that interact with and modify Dovecot Cluster tags.

GLOBAL OPTIONS

Global doveadm(1) options:

-D

Enables verbosity and debug messages.

-O

Do not read any config file, just use defaults.

-k

Preserve entire environment for doveadm, not just import_environment.

-v

Enables verbosity, including progress counter.

-i instance-name

If using multiple Dovecot instances, choose the config file based on this instance name. See instance_name setting for more information.

-c config-file

Read configuration from the given config-file. By default it first reads config socket, and then falls back to /etc/dovecot/dovecot.conf. You can also point this to config socket of some instance running compatible version.

-o setting=value

Overrides the configuration setting from /etc/dovecot/dovecot.conf and from the userdb with the given value. In order to override multiple settings, the -o option may be specified multiple times.

-f formatter

Specifies the formatter for formatting the output. Supported formatters are:

flow

prints each line with key=value pairs.

pager

prints each key: value pair on its own line and separates records with form feed character (^L).

tab

prints a table header followed by tab separated value lines.

table

prints a table header followed by adjusted value lines.

Warning

Currently there is no checks whether tags are being used or not. Changing a tag UUID, or removing a tag that is in use, can cause problems.

COMMANDS

cluster tag create

doveadm [GLOBAL OPTIONS] cluster tag create [ --id id ] name

Creates a new tag for cluster. UUID can be provided, if not, it will be generated.

cluster tag remove

doveadm [GLOBAL OPTIONS] cluster tag remove name|id

Remove a tag. This currently has no safety checks, so be sure to remove first all of the tag’s sites.

cluster tag update

doveadm [GLOBAL OPTIONS] cluster tag update [ --name name ] name|id

Change tag name.

cluster tag list

doveadm [GLOBAL OPTIONS] cluster tag list

List all tags.
